Water demand Environment Act target delivery plan
Statutory Environment Act target
Reduce the use of public water supply in England per head of population by 20% by 2038 from a 2019 to 2020 baseline.
Interim targets
Public water supply:
Reduce the use of public water supply in England per head of population by 9% by 31 March 2027 and by 14% by 31 March 2032 from a 2019 to 2020 baseline.
Leakage:
Reduce leakage by 20% by 31 March 2027 and by 30% by 31 March 2032 from a 2017 to 2018 baseline.
Rationale for the interim targets: why and how they will progress delivery of the Environment Act target
Our interim targets are ambitious and will help achieve the long-term target. The targets have been largely adopted by the industry and form a key basis of water companies’ Water Resource Management Plans (WRMPs).
Our calculations, conducted in 2022 using WRMP19 forecast data, showed that, if all commitments and proposed policies are implemented as expected, we could overdeliver the long-term target by up to approximately 54%. Having extra policies and delivery interventions in place enables us to maintain our delivery confidence in both the interim and long-term targets. By the end of 2026, we will conduct an updated analysis of our commitments and proposed policies which will take into consideration the latest context and new data. This will provide an up-to-date picture of our target trajectories.
The latest Environment Agency (EA) summary of Water Resource Management Plan Annual Review data shows that water demand has fallen in 2024 to 2025. As of 2024 to 2025, public water supply per person is 5.1% below the 2019 to 2020 baseline. This is where we would expect it to be at this early stage of target delivery, and it will be important that this downward trend is maintained to meet the target. Our interim targets provide us with a strong base to meeting our statutory target and we will continue to work to accelerate progress against this through our activities.
Realisation of the interim leakage target is dependent on water companies reducing leakage to their committed levels. We are working alongside Ofwat to ensure performance against this target is embedded through performance commitments and the 2024 Price Review (PR24). PR24 represents the largest investment programme in the water sector for 30 years. This provides a step change in funding and incentives to drive sustained leakage reduction and support delivery of our targets.
Delivery measures
Government is not responsible for all the levers expected to contribute to the statutory and interim targets, and so we have included additional policy and delivery interventions to provide additional headroom.
Table 1: Summary of leakage and water demand reduction measures and supporting evidence under the water demand delivery plan
| Delivery measure | Description | Estimated contribution to the interim targets | Evidence of impact | Responsible | Status |
|---|---|---|---|---|---|
| Ofwat regulation | We will work with Ofwat (Water Services Regulation Authority) to hold water companies to account for delivering leakage reduction targets through Ofwat’s rewards and penalties. Water companies have already committed to reducing leakage by 50% by 2050. We will work with Ofwat to ensure they remain on this trajectory which will help drive water demand down. | High | Leakage has reduced by an estimated 12.4% since 2017 to 2018. Ofwat’s PR24 Final Determinations require companies to cut leakage by 17% over 2025 to 2030, backed by around £700 million for pressure management, leak repairs and mains replacement. Water companies have also committed to halve leakage by 2050. The Strategic Policy Statement, which sets out Defra’s expectations of Ofwat, outlines that we expect Ofwat to hold water companies to their leakage trajectories through incentives and penalties. |
Ofwat | In delivery |
| Accelerating Smart meter rollout | We will consider policies or standards associated with water usage data to enable water companies to incentivise more water efficient behaviours and reduce leakage, including amplifying the benefits of the smart meter rollout. In our Water White Paper, we have committed to unlocking barriers to accelerate the rollout of smart metering and expanding customer access to smart meter data. There is clear evidence this will deliver better outcomes, fairer bills and improved water resilience. |
High | Water companies are aiming to install approximately 10.4 million smart meters over 2025 to 2030, increasing smart metering to around 50% of households and businesses by 2030. Moving from unmetered to smart metered can reduce consumption by up to 17%, while smart meters also improve leakage detection and customer access to usage data. |
Defra and Ofwat | In development |
| Mandatory water efficiency labelling scheme (MWELS) | We will introduce MWELS on water using products such as showers and toilets. This will allow consumers to be better informed around their water usage. The label will also give customers more information to help them make informed decisions about water efficient products when purchasing. |
Medium low | MWELs is a key government intervention to support consumers to use water more efficiently. It is expected to meet around 20% of the remaining supply-demand gap by 2050. MWELs could save consumers £56 million on water bills and £69 million on energy bills over 10 years, with cumulative water savings of 22,509 ML. The label is intended to shift purchasing towards more efficient products and remove poorer-performing products from the market over time. |
Defra | In development |
| Introduce minimum standards | We will consider introducing minimum water efficiency product standards and design guidance to reduce water wastage and remove inefficient or unclear products from the market following the launch of MWELS. | Medium low | Minimum product standards would complement the label by removing the least efficient products from the market and setting a clear maximum flow performance threshold. The label plus standards could help meet an additional share of the 2050 gap by driving more efficient product uptake. In addition, they could reduce water wastage and encourage innovation and competition among manufacturers. |
Defra | In development |
| Review water efficiency standards in Building Regulations 2010 | We will work with Ministry of Housing, Communities and Local Government (MHCLG) to explore whether the Building Regulations 2010 could be further amended to tighten water efficiency standards and enable consumers to use less water and save on their water and energy bills, as well as to assess where planning policy can enable water efficiency at the point of housing delivery. This could see an amended standard in Part G of the Building Regulations being introduced for new homes in England through fittings from 125 l/p/d (litres per person per day) to 105 l/p/d, and 100 l/p/d where there is a clear local need (such as in areas of water stress). We will also review the water recycling and drainage standards in Part H of the Building Regulations 2010, to enable water reuse. |
Medium low | Tightening water efficiency standards in Building Regulations from 125 litres per person per day to 105 litres, and to 100 litres where there is clear local need will support the statutory demand target. It will help unblock development in water-scarce areas. It will also save families over £111 a year on water and energy bills in new homes. A reduction of 20 litres per person per day could unlock an additional 1,000 homes for every 5,250 homes built. |
Defra, MHCLG, Building Safety Regulator (BSR) | In development |
| Review planning policy and processes in new household development | We will progress work to consider the role of water companies in large scale development, following the recommendations of the Independent Water Commission for an enhanced role in this process. In our Water White Paper, we committed to facilitating the adoption of reused water, including through planning. We also committed to reviewing the right to connect to water supply for domestic and non-domestic purposes. This will look to solutions such as water reuse options, water efficient retrofits and dual pipe systems. |
Low | Stronger planning and earlier water company involvement will help ensure new developments are designed around water efficiency and local water constraints from the outset. The interventions in the White Paper support a more joined-up planning framework. Tighter local standards are already being used in areas such as Cambridge and North Sussex where water scarcity is constraining housing growth. Better alignment between planning and water management should reduce future water-related barriers to development. |
Defra, MHCLG | In development |
| Enable water reuse in new household development | We will review and amend relevant legislation as appropriate to address wasteful product issues with toilets and enable new water efficient technologies. | Low | Water reuse systems can reduce demand on potable water supplies, lower carbon emissions and improve flood resilience. Customers with reuse systems may see lower bills. Additionally, dual pipe and reuse systems can reduce abstraction pressure while supporting wider drainage and storm overflow benefits. Government is reviewing the relevant regulatory framework to enable these systems at development scale. |
Defra, MHCLG | In development |
| Review planning for non-household development | We will review planning policy and processes and investigate water reuse options for new non-household development. Consider voluntary schemes for non-household buildings and work with MHCLG and local authorities to improve knowledge and guidance of water reuse in planning processes. | Low | Water reuse in non-household settings can materially reduce pressure on potable supplies and free up water for homes and priority infrastructure. Greywater and rainwater reuse can reduce water consumption in some non-household settings by approximately 50 to 75%, including for large users such as data centres. This would support growth while improving resilience and reducing the risk of non-household water moratoriums. |
Defra, DWI, MHCLG | In development |
| Work with partners to reduce non-household usage | We will work closely with the retail Market Operator of England’s non-household Water Market (MOSL), regulators, water companies and retailers to identify options to drive non-household demand down. This includes through MOSL’s Market Performance Framework (MPF) standards, Ofwat’s new non-household performance commitment for water companies to reduce business demand for water (including managing penalties and rewards) and reviewing tariff structures in the non-household market to better understand incentives for water efficiency and demand reduction. | Low | Non-household consumption accounts for around 20% of total water demand, and the top 1% of users account for around half of that use. Reducing business demand is important for resilience and growth. Working with MOSL, Ofwat, retailers and companies on market performance, tariffs and incentives will enable the highest-using businesses to accelerate water demand reductions. |
Defra | In development |

Monitoring and evaluation summary
Water companies annually report water distribution input (DI) figures (including components of DI and total population) to the EA and Ofwat (through WRMP and water company annual performance reports respectively), in line with existing reporting requirements. Annual figures are taken in line with financial years from April to March. This annual data is used by the EA to monitor progress in delivering programmes to manage supply and demand, as well as those aimed at protecting the environment.
This reporting is the source of the baseline 2019 to 2020 figure and will be how the Water demand target is reported. It should be noted that targets relating to leakage will be reported using a 2017 to 2018 baseline, in line with pre-existing industry reporting processes. There are some shared water supply zones on the border with Wales where the population in England are supplied by Welsh Water, however these are not included in the baseline, nor will they be included in annual reporting.
The EA will calculate the metric annually from data provided by water companies in annual reports on their WRMPs. This reporting is statutory, but the content is defined by guidance from the EA. Reporting for the demand target will include taking data from the reports and aggregating the company-level DI data. The EA will divide the total DI (Megalitres per day) by total population (household and non-household) figures (as supplied by water companies), also provided in these annual reports, to produce a DI/population figure in Megalitres per person per day. The EA technical guidance suggests population is updated by water companies using Office for National Statistics (ONS) data or billing records but can also use WRMP forecast data for that recording year.
Additionally, guidance sets out they need to highlight and explain any changes to the demand forecast, including population and property forecasting. Detail any change to the source data set used for forecasting.

Policies that support the water demand target will be evaluated. For example, we are currently commissioning a 5 year evaluation plan for MWELS. As part of this we are also commissioning the development of a methodology to measure water usage in the home at a granular level and use this to calculate the water savings from MWELS.
